Abstract
The French Society of Stomatology, Oral and Maxillofacial Surgery (SFSCMFCO) together with the Medical Society of Dento-Maxillofacial Orthopedics has drawn up in 2015Â a new practice guideline concerning the management of one or several impacted cuspids. As the previous ones, this guideline is based on a rigorous French Heath Regulation Authorities type methodology. It is thus intended to become a major reference in its field. We report hereafter the short version of the text in the same way it has been presented during the 2015Â French National Congress of the SFSCMFCO in Lyon -Â France. Each of these recommendations is marked A, B or C according to a decreasing evidence based rating scale. Lacking any evidence-based data, the recommendation is considered as an expert opinion (AE).
